Key Players in the Regulatory Circus

  • Fire Marshals: The gatekeepers who’ll make you rethink that "creative" battery cabinet placement
  • Local AHJs (Authority Having Jurisdiction): These folks hold more power than your battery’s inverter
  • Insurance Providers: The silent partners who’ll either hug you or haunt you at renewal time
